“‘The Last of the Mohicans’ is perhaps the most popular of the books written by James Femimore Cooper and is the second of the series of five novels known as the ‘Leather Stocking Tales.’ These stories were written in the following order: ‘The Pioneers,’ ‘The Last of the Mohicans,’ ‘The Prairie,’ ‘The Pathfinder,’ and ‘The Deerslayer.’ James Fenimore Cooper was born at Burlington, N. J., September 15, 1789, and was the eleventh of twelve children. When he was thirteen months old his parents moved to Cooperstown, N. Y., which is situated at the southern end of Otsego lake, and there in the midst of wild and picturesque surroundings the author’s early life was spent. The influence of these environments is manifest in many of his works. His first book, a novel of high life in England, was published in 1820, and although the work was a failure it came so near being a success that Cooper was encouraged to repeat the attempt. In 1825 he wrote ‘The Pioneers’ which at once established his reputation as an author. One year later he produced ‘The Last of the Mohicans.’ The plan of this story is laid in one of the most interesting sections of New York State; interesting for the reason that it is famous for the beauty and grandeur of its scenery, and from the fact that in that vicinity were enacted some of the most tragic scenes in the history of this country.” -The School Journal

“Love of country was a passion with Cooper, and he naturally sought his subject among the scenes of the Revolution. John Jay’s account of a spy who was in his service during the war, led him to write ‘The Spy.’ By this novel he became known. It was translated into several of the languages of Europe. In 1823 appeared ‘The Pioneers,’ itself the pioneer of the Leather Stocking tales. In it he described the manners and customs of his native land; and laying the scene about Otsego Lake, he was able to make use of the impressions and memories of his boyhood. ‘The Pilot,’ the first of his sea tales, was made vivid by the scenes and characters drawn from his own experience, and attained great popularity. In 1825, taking an excursion with a party of Englishmen to Lake George, the caverns at Glenn’s Falls were examined with interest, and he promised Lord Derby that he would write a romance in which they should be introduced. In ‘The Last of the Mohicans,’ 1826, that promise was fulfilled. His delineations of Indian life established the reputation already gained by ‘The Spy.’ Treating of a new country and a new race, the novelty of its scenes and characters caused the book to be widely read in Europe. In 1826 Cooper went abroad and spent six years in literary labor. ‘The Prairie’ was finished in Paris.” -Digest of Literature

James Fenimore Cooper was a nineteenth-century American author and political critic. Esteemed by many for his Romantic style, Cooper became popular for his depiction of Native Americans in fiction. Before Cooper considered himself a writer, he was expelled from Yale University, served as a midshipman for the United States Navy, and became a gentleman farmer. Cooper wrote many notable works including The Pioneers, The Last of the Mohicans, and The Red Rover, which was adapted and performed on stage in 1828. Cooper passed away in 1851 at the age of 61.
